69L78 wrote:
Is a 512 casting block (427-454) allowed to replace a 272 casting block (396) in stock appearing? I'm assuming it's okay since block casting #'s don't have to be correct.

:dragster


Correct as long as block deck, cam location Etc are all the same as the 272 casting block you are OK.
